Output 304080aa9eedf24c6de61f2c3d73a17263aec4414e3feaa933a511761e2ebe26:2

value
44082527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e41f1e00436d64fdcd8e50e8c8a54665825b4ba2 OP_EQUAL
address
MUhMaEAtVRWYUaYbHha9C2eGaQNF9tBdqS
transaction
304080aa9eedf24c6de61f2c3d73a17263aec4414e3feaa933a511761e2ebe26
spent
true